Commit graph

27 commits

Author SHA1 Message Date
Daniel
41ffb2c72d Improve windows kext bandwidth stats monitor 2023-07-20 14:02:50 +02:00
Daniel
28d3d24988 Add and improve InfoOnly and ExpectInfo packet flags 2023-07-18 16:16:41 +02:00
Vladimir Stoilov
83479acc95 Add example for getting bandwidth stats 2023-06-30 16:56:39 +03:00
Daniel
8a09ba6045 Revamp connection handling flow to fix race condition and support info-only packets 2023-06-21 15:31:45 +02:00
Vladimir Stoilov
f754555979 Add reading of the pid from the kext 2023-06-13 18:03:22 +03:00
Vladimir
a1a2338619 Added shutdown request for kext 2022-11-24 09:57:34 +01:00
vladimir
c43f6fe463 minor refactoring 2022-11-10 17:36:58 +02:00
Vladimir
075f9151cd More efficient verdict update structure 2022-11-08 16:53:54 +01:00
Vladimir
8b8755458e fix sending update verdict info 2022-11-08 16:39:26 +01:00
Vladimir
7a639be526 Merge branch 'fix/remove-glue-library' into fix/verdict-cache-update 2022-11-08 10:14:37 +01:00
Vladimir
3768db6b32 Removed legacy code and refactoring 2022-11-07 11:07:49 +01:00
Vladimir
ad8bb2059d Version and update verdict kernel functions 2022-11-04 11:21:53 +01:00
Vladimir
1ff27784c3 Refactoring and more comments 2022-11-02 15:03:26 -07:00
Daniel
c3d94efab9 Add support for fast-tracking connections within the OS integration 2021-04-19 23:13:06 +02:00
Daniel
5d0db1c250 Attempt to fix windows lint errors again 2020-10-15 12:18:57 +02:00
Daniel
9e8b763428 Fix windows kext warning on shutdown 2020-10-15 11:48:27 +02:00
Daniel
7649859ba6 Switch connection state lookups to use the packet.Info struct
Also, rename the Direction attribute on packet.Info to Inbound
2020-05-18 17:08:32 +02:00
Daniel
886d30278f Fix IPv4 parsing from windows state tables 2020-05-16 22:43:42 +02:00
Daniel
cb991e9f02 Fix and improve IP address conversion on windows 2020-05-15 17:16:08 +02:00
Daniel
fd4f059ebb Fix windowskext linter errors 2020-04-10 13:18:37 +02:00
Daniel
f75fc7d162 Clean up linter errors 2019-11-07 16:13:22 +01:00
Daniel
92ccb36952 Add windows build constraint to windowskext package 2019-09-25 12:00:26 +02:00
Daniel
9741bc412e Update org import paths 2019-07-02 15:12:31 +02:00
Daniel
5eb956a9c3 Fix IPv6 parsing in windows kext handler 2019-05-22 16:07:46 +02:00
Daniel
6495b4fe5f Add GetOrFindPrimaryProcess to correctly group process/threads 2019-04-26 15:17:44 +02:00
Daniel
78a0b3c1fb Add windowskext integration, update related packages 2019-04-26 11:33:28 +02:00
Daniel
74e1b0e8e9 [WIP] 2019-03-18 08:41:58 +01:00